Before Ghana’s plays its first game in Cote D’Ivoire, Black Stars defender Mohammed Salisu was captured in a trending video on Instagram after getting a haircut.

Barber Jean Kero showed off his “well lit” cut of Salisu’s hair before the AS Monaco player takes to the field against the Blue Sharks of Cape Verde. (Click highlighted text to watch video)

Salisu is likely to start for the Black Stars on his return to the team after a lengthy lay off due to injury following his move from Southampton to the French Ligue 1 side.

Ghana is in Group B with Egypt, Cape Verde and Mozambique at the 2023 AFCON.
